Day 1: Define Objectives and Budget
Set Clear Goals
Start by determining the objectives of your offsite. Is it to brainstorm new product features, enhance team cohesion, or align on strategic goals?
Budget Breakdown
Establish your budget early. Here’s a quick template:
- Venue: 40%
- Food & Beverage (F&B): 25%
- Activities: 15%
- Travel: 15%
- Contingency: 5%
For example, if your total budget is $10,000, allocate:
- Venue: $4,000
- F&B: $2,500
- Activities: $1,500
- Travel: $1,500
- Contingency: $500

Day 3: Book the Venue and Accommodations
Insider Tips
- Book Direct: Many venues offer a 15% discount when you book directly.
- Room Blocks: Request a room block early to secure accommodations for your team.

Day 5: Finalize Logistics and Vendor Coordination
Vendor Coordination Checklist
- Catering: Confirm F&B details (lead time: 3 days).
- Transportation: Arrange shuttle services (lead time: 2 days).
- AV Needs: Confirm tech setup (lead time: 1 day).
Day 6: Prepare for Contingencies
Risk Mitigation
- Weather Issues: Have indoor alternatives ready for outdoor activities.
- Catering Issues: Confirm orders 24 hours before the event.
Day 7: Execute and Follow Up
Day-of Checklist
- Confirm all vendor arrivals.
- Ensure team members have all necessary materials.
- Schedule a debrief session at the end of the offsite for feedback.
